Announcing Jacket 14, a co-production with SALT magazine,
with a special feature of writing from or about France, at

        http://www.jacket.zip.com.au/jacket14/index.html


----- Articles:

Charles Bernstein: Poetry and/or the Sacred
Graham Foust: Wallace Stevens's Manuscript:
        As If in The Dump
Lyn Hejinian: Continuing Against Closure
Marjorie Perloff: on Wittgenstein and Duchamp
Susan M. Schultz: Of Time and Charles Bernstein's Lines:
        A Poetics of Fashion Statements
Brian Kim Stefans: Veronica Forrest-Thomson and High Artifice

----- Feature: France - Edited by Tracy Ryan

Judith Bishop: on Yves Bonnefoy
Pamela Brown: Paris, France
Maryline Desbiolles trans. Tracy Ryan
Rachel Blau DuPlessis
Lorand Gaspar trans. Peter Riley
Franck André Jamme trans. Olivier Brossard and Lisa Lubasch
Vénus Khoury-Ghata, trans. Marilyn Hacker
Harry Mathews: Rue de Rochechouart
Michael Scharf: The Hills of Dublin and Czernowitz...
John Tranter: In Paris

----- Prose:

Carla Harryman: From Gardener of Stars - a novel

----- Reviews:

Juliana Spahr reviews Rob Wilson, Reimagining the American Pacific
Maria Damon reviews Joseph Lease, Human Rights
Lucy Sheerman reviews Jennifer Moxley, Grace Lake and John Forbes

----- Poems:

Chris Andrews, Jan Baeke (trans. Rod Mengham), Mary Jo Bang, Douglas
Barbour, Anselm Berrigan, Richard Caddel, Alfred Corn, Bei Dao (trans.
Eliot Weinberger and Iona Man-Cheong), Catherine Daly, Marcella Durand,
Elaine Equi, michael farrell, Bob Harrison, Coral Hull, Kate Lilley, Victor
Hugo Limón (trans. Mark Weiss), Drew Milne, Peter Minter, Ted Nielsen,
Kevin Nolan, Ian Patterson, Gig Ryan, Michael Scharf, Joanna Smith Rakoff,
Office for Soft Architecture, Candice Ward, McKenzie Wark, Mark Weiss,
Marjorie Welish, and Susan Wheeler

----- Poetry and Sculpture:

Robert Creeley: Scholar's Rocks: with sculpture by Jim Dine

----- This issue of Jacket is a co-production with SALT magazine, an
international journal of poetry and poetics, edited by John Kinsella, PO
Box 937, Great Wilbraham, Cambridge PDO, CB1 5JX United Kingdom - ISSN
1324-7131.
This means that the contents of Jacket 14 will appear in print (as SALT
number 13, late in 2001) as well as electronically, a first for both
magazines.

Jacket is a free Internet-only literary magazine which I publish from
Sydney Australia. The thirteen issues so far published since Issue # 1 in
October 1997 (all issues will remain permanently "there") have attracted
over a quarter of a million visits. I'm not quite sure what that means, but
it sounds vaguely positive to me.
